Computers – A Human Right?
The matter of human rights is one that polarizes viewpoint like few others. Where would they begin and end, when does a person forfeit one or more of those rights? That is why it was interesting when the United Nations began a push to announce Access to the internet to become a human right on its own. It seems like a bizarre pronouncement – when lots of people cannot afford a computer, how could it be a human right?
It depends, obviously, upon how you look at the issue. Certainly, you will find nations where Access to the internet is restricted even for individuals who can pay for it. You don’t have to have a computer in their home, either, to get into the web, since the existence of Internet cafs in many towns and cities will show. So is it the potential of Internet access that’s a human right, instead of the provision of it?
It is becoming a lot more difficult to have a level playing field if you are not at least able to access the Internet – regardless of whether you intend to, and whether you can afford to make use of it as much as you want to or as much as other people are going to. For informational purposes, the Internet is oftentimes the only way that you can find important information.
The promise of Access to the internet as a human right is becoming more important in a technological and legal sense, as some governments and companies look to restrict individual’s access for one reason or another. The option to punish illegal downloaders by removing their access away could be said to breach this right, and is one that is meeting opposition in “free countries” – and the same goes for the blocking of many Internet sites by some more closed nations.
